#3446f1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3446f1 is composed of 20.4% red, 27.5% green and 94.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.4% cyan, 71%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 234.3 degrees, a saturation of 87.1% and a lightness of 57.5%. #3446f1 color hex could be obtained by blending #688cff with #0000e3.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

#3446f1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3446f1 has RGB values of R:52, G:70, B:241 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0.71,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 3426033.

Shades and Tints of #3446f1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010311 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#3446f1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#909095 is the less saturated color, while #2c3ff9 is the most saturated one.
